- [ ] **Formula sandbox check** — Before cutting the Tallyhook release, run the full escape-test suite against user-supplied formulas. Last quarter someone's spreadsheet macro reached the filesystem through a sloppy eval shim, so don't skip this. Confirm the sandbox denies network, clock skew tricks, and recursion bombs. Sign off in the Quartzline tracker, and paste the verification run's token, which appears below.

build token for kahop-kagag: htk31_38a3512afc721db8009f808ec553b14

Handover: Renderflow markdown pipeline (from Dario to Lissa). Welcome aboard. The pipeline converts author markdown through three stages: sanitize, render, and cache. Stage configs live in the pipeline repo under /stages; never edit the cache stage without draining the queue first, or you'll serve stale fragments. If the render worker's credential store locks up — it happens after three bad deploys — you'll need to run the recovery script from the ops box. It prompts for a passphrase, which is recorded below.

strongbox words: sorir-belvan-rusix-ulays-ralmir-praix-eliir-tamax-praael-druael-julir-tamius-jorir

The Harrowgate sweeper, intended to reclaim detached volumes in the Velmont compute cluster, began flagging live resources as orphans because its inventory snapshot was eleven minutes stale. Tomas paused the sweeper queue before any deletions executed, then rebuilt the snapshot index from the authoritative Corbel ledger. Future maintainers: always verify snapshot freshness before re-enabling sweep mode, and never raise the batch size during recovery. The sweeper binary deployed after this incident carries the trace token shown below.

build token for kagaf-hahof: htk14_9d3d4d26d7d8de

Ticket VLT-providing access — heya! The Kestrelwood vault holding the sampling config for ChatterDuck (yes, our chattiest service) locked itself after the rotation job failed twice. We need it open to dial log sampling back down from 100% before storage melts. Since you're the assigned security reviewer, please approve the unlock using the passphrase below.

vault phrase of kawep-tahog = ulaix-briath